Abstract

Abstract. Blended learning is a learning model that lecturers can apply to optimize the learning outcomes. This study, entitled "The Effectiveness of Blended Learning to Increase Student Motivation" aims to determine the extent of the effectiveness of Blended Learning in increasing the learning motivation on the first semester students of the English Literature Study Program at Khairun University. This research was carried out at the English Literature Study Program a quasi-experimental study designed on using the non-equivalent control group design. A total of 50 on the first semester students were sampled in this study. The sample was divided into 2 classes, experimental class used blended learning and the control class used face-to-face learning, each consisted of 25 students. The learning motivation questionnaire was used as the instrument in collecting the data related to students learning motivation. The results showed that there were significant differences between students learning motivation in the experimental class and students in the control class after had been given different treatments. The researcher also found that the application of Blended Learning was effective in increasing the learning motivation of the first semester students of English Literature Study Program at Khairun University.
